Output 68f53af496601d310ff99baf5037ddd49c1e4c2bca90753e076a195a2528633e:63

value
93321509
script pubkey
OP_0 OP_PUSHBYTES_32 edddd5f1e720fa3572dcacf15b6ffade38d198693138c7ad9189e359bc2b69da
address
bc1qahwatu08yrar2uku4nc4kml6mcudrxrfxyuv0tv33834n0ptd8dqu6lv0d
transaction
68f53af496601d310ff99baf5037ddd49c1e4c2bca90753e076a195a2528633e
spent
true